How Much Does Lawn Care Service Cost in Port Orange?

The Short Answer


Professional lawn care service in Port Orange typically ranges from $40 to $70 per month for basic lawn treatment programs and can exceed $100 per month for comprehensive lawn care that includes pest control, disease management and irrigation advice. Basic Lawn Treatment Programs


Entry-level lawn programs from national lawn service brands typically offer a fixed schedule of fertilization and weed control. They will send their technician on a regular schedule, apply their generic fertilizer, leave a yard sign, and move on to the next customer.


For many homeowners with relatively healthy lawns, this level of service may be sufficient to maintain a respectable appearance. However, lawns in Florida often face additional challenges that basic programs do not address. The reasons why a basic one-size-fits-all approach will fail are:


  • Extended hot temperatures can trigger heat stress in St Augustine grass requiring different fertilizer and watering schedules

  • Strong afternoon thunderstorms can contribute to over-watering if sprinkler schedules aren't adjusted accordingly

  • Improper mowing, too much or too little water, and incorrect fertilization can quickly lead to a chinch bug infestation

  • Too much fertilizer, over watering and poor drainage can lead to the spread of Brown Patch Fungus when nighttime temperatures drop below 85 degrees.


Why a Comprehensive Lawn Care Program Makes More Sense


A more complete lawn care program goes beyond fertilizer. An experienced, professional lawn care company adjust their treatments accordingly because they monitor for:


  • Chinch bugs

  • Sod webworms

  • Mole crickets

  • Lawn disease

  • Nutrient deficiencies

  • Irrigation-related issues


This proactive approach, built-in to a comprehensive lawn care program, can prevent minor problems from becoming expensive lawn repairs. When homeowners on a basic program wait to complain to their provider when they see visible damage, the cost of recovery is often much higher than the cost of prevention. What About Weed Control?


Weed control is one of the most common reasons homeowners hire a lawn service. Weeds thrive in Florida's climate and are especially visible when the lawn becomes thin or stressed. Common examples of weeds found in Florida lawns include:


  • Dollarweed

  • Spurge

  • Crabgrass

  • Florida pusley

  • Chamberbitter


A Comprehensive Lawn Care program combines pre-emergent and post-emergent treatments throughout the year to control each of these weeds before they happen. This proactive, ongoing strategy will produce better results than DIY applications applied after the weeds are already visible.

What Should You Look For in a Lawn Service Company?


When comparing lawn care companies, ask the following questions:


  • How many treatments are included annually?

  • Is weed control included?

  • Do you monitor for lawn insects?

  • Do you inspect for disease?

  • Are treatments for insects and disease included in the price?

  • Will someone evaluate irrigation issues?

  • Are quotes free?


The answers often reveal more value than price alone.


Why Local Experience Matters


Florida lawns are unique. St. Augustine grass faces challenges that are very different from lawns found in northern states. A locally based company familiar with Port Orange, New Smyrna Beach, Daytona Beach, and Ormond Beach understands:


  • Local soil conditions

  • Seasonal weather patterns

  • Common lawn pests and diseases

  • Irrigation restrictions and best times to water

  • Regional turfgrass issues


Local knowledge often leads to better long-term results.
